How Much is Tuition at Colleges Near Waterloo, Iowa That Offer Nursing (RN-BSN & BSN) Degrees?
According to 2023 data from Lightcast™, the average cost of in-state undergraduate degree tuition and fees at colleges and universities near Waterloo, Iowa has been increasing over the past five years. In 2023, the average annual cost of tuition and fees for the 9 schools near Waterloo was $17,103. That represents a 5% increase since 2019.

Tuition Costs by School Type Near Waterloo, Iowa
There are at least 10 schools serving Waterloo, Iowa. Of those schools, 3 are 4-year private nonprofit schools and 5 are 2-year public schools based on information collected by the U.S. College Scorecard. There are at least 3 4-year private nonprofit institutions serving Waterloo, Iowa. The average tuition among those schools in 2022-23 was $33,776, which represents a 5% decrease from the previous year.

There are at least 5 2-year public institutions serving Waterloo, Iowa. The average tuition among those schools in 2022-23 was $5,989, which represents a 4% increase from the previous year.
